Join us on Thursday, May 21, from 12:00 - 1:00 p.m., in Auditorium A at University Hospital, as Dr. Brian Keller, discusses “Beyond Checkpoint Inhibition: Remodeling the Tumor Immune Microenvironment in GI and GU Cancers.”

Date: Thursday, May 21, 2026
Time: 12:00 – 1:00 p.m.
Location: Auditorium A, University Hospital

Learning objectives:

  1. Understand the relationship between mismatch repair status, tumour mutational burden, and response to immune checkpoint inhibition in GI and GU cancers
  2. Describe the mechanisms by which oncolytic virotherapy disrupts the immunosuppressive tumour microenvironment and primes anti-tumour immunity.
  3. Examine the cellular and molecular composition of the immunosuppressive tumour microenvironment in GI and GU cancers, with a focus on emerging immune cell populations as potential therapeutic targets.
